Walpole, NH is a small town located near the Connecticut River. It is known for its charm and quaint atmosphere, as well as offering great affordability when it comes to rent. 2 bedroom apartments in Walpole have an average rent of $1,340 – significantly lower than the national average of $1,430. Additionally, grocery costs are also relatively lower in Walpole with a Grocery Cost Index of 105 compared to 100 for the US.

Walpole has an unemployment rate of 2.5%. The US average is 6.0%.

Walpole has seen the job market decrease by -4.4% over the last year. Future job growth over the next ten years is predicted to be 23.5%, which is lower than the US average of 33.5%.

Tax Rates for Walpole
- The Sales Tax Rate for Walpole is 0.0%. The US average is 7.3%.
- The Income Tax Rate for Walpole is 0.0%. The US average is 4.6%.
- Tax Rates can have a big impact when Comparing Cost of Living.

Income and Salaries for Walpole
- The average income of a Walpole resident is $38,766 a year. The US average is $37,638 a year.
- The Median household income of a Walpole resident is $71,607 a year. The US average is $69,021 a year.
